LIVONIA, MI--Virginia Tile Company (“Virginia Tile,” or the “Company”), the premier specialty distributor of ceramic, porcelain and natural stone tile and related products to the professional commercial and residential markets across the Midwest, is pleased to announce the hire of Edmund ‘Ed’ Vaske as Chief Operating Officer. Ed Vaske is a supply chain management specialist with a proven track record in supply chain transformation, strategic sourcing and implementing operational strategies for mid-size to Fortune 500 organizations. Before joining VTC, Vaske was the vice president of transportation and distribution of Casey’s General Stores based in Ankeny, Iowa, a major chain of convenience stores in the Midwestern and Southern United States. Prior to that, Vaske was the vice president of business development of Jacobson Companies, a third-party Logistics Company offering end-to-end global supply chain management solutions. Vaske has also held significant leadership roles at MW Logistics and Ruan Transportation in Dallas, TX, and Des Moines, Iowa, respectively.

Headquartered in Livonia, MI, Virginia Tile serves 16 Midwestern states from Ohio to Kansas to North Dakota. Its vast network of 18 award-winning showrooms and distribution centers to provide a superior customer experience along with efficient order fulfillment serviced by two hubs in Livonia, MI and Kansas City, MO.
